Re-issues often knock the price and sometimes it works the other way. Where LP's are concerned, it's more about LP collectors who are often a different type of buyer to DJ's.

LP collectors often want the original to "slot" and DJ's may pay big bucks, if there is/are an "Indemand" track/tracks only available on an LP ......supply and demand always works but this LP has 2 markets potentially
